Marie Brooker, founder of Wolf&Root, will launch the South West’s first Canine Wellbeing Retreat this summer. Combining grooming with wellbeing practices, the retreat aims to provide a calm environment for dogs, especially those anxious about grooming. It will focus on nervous system care, using natural products and allowing extended appointment times, limiting each stylist to three dogs per day. Brooker, with over ten years of experience, emphasizes emotional wellbeing alongside grooming. The retreat’s approach challenges traditional high-volume grooming, promoting animal welfare, and aims to set a new standard in the grooming industry. Bookings will open on July 1.
